Named a Finalist in 'Best Security Company' and 'Best Enterprise Security
Solution' Categories
PALO ALTO, Calif., Dec. 19 /PRNewswire/ -- PGP Corporation, a global
leader in enterprise data security and encryption solutions, today
announced that the company has been nominated for two Excellence Awards
from SC Magazine. PGP Corporation has been named a finalist in both the
"Best Security Company" and "Best Enterprise Security Solution" categories.
Winners will be announced on February 6, 2007, at a gala during the RSA(R)
Conference 2007 in San Francisco. For more information, visit:
http://www.scmagazine.com/us/awards/ .

Nominated as best enterprise security solution, the PGP(R) Encryption
Platform and set of integrated applications protect sensitive and
confidential information wherever it resides. In use at 95 of the 2006
Fortune(R) 100 companies and 87 percent of Germany's DAX index, the PGP
Encryption Platform secures email, laptops, desktops, instant messaging,
PDAs, network storage, FTP and bulk data transfers, and backups, enabling
organizations to reap best-in-class encryption in phases or as business
requirements emerge and evolve. The increasing threats to confidential
information, along with global regulations and security best practices,
contribute to continued acceptance of PGP(R) technology.
About the PGP Encryption Platform
The PGP Encryption Platform lowers operational costs and accelerates
application deployment through a single management console for centralized
policy and configuration. The platform provides multiple layers of
encryption across a global enterprise with comprehensive policy
enforcement, key management, recovery, and reporting services. A true
enterprise offering, the PGP Encryption Platform is extensible, providing
standards-based interfaces for third-party developers, such as Research In
Motion(R) (RIM(R)), to leverage services. The RIM-developed PGP(R) Support
Package for BlackBerry(R) uses the same keys, policies, and configuration
as other PGP Encryption Platform-enabled applications. The platform also
integrates with third-party enterprise solutions, including directory
services and PKIs as well as email hygiene and outbound content compliance
solutions.
